About Romy

Meet Romy, a stunning Anatolian Shepherd who brings a quiet charm to any environment. At 2 years old and a solid 90 pounds, she’s looking for a calm and loving home where she can thrive. Rescued from a hoarding situation, Romy is a bit on the timid side, making a serene atmosphere essential for her happiness. This isn’t your energetic pup; she prefers relaxing in the garden or curling up on a soft dog bed, observing the world around her. Romy definitely needs a fenced yard for safety and would do well with a confident canine companion to help her settle in. Although she’s good with both dogs and cats, she's not a social butterfly and prefers the company of her favorite humans in a quiet space. If you can provide her with a serene environment at around 72 degrees, you’ll find her in her version of paradise.
